Happenings in the Beeyard - 2014 Update

4/29/2014

0 Comments

 
Well we survived the Winter of 2013/2014 but unfortunately are Honey bees did not fair quite as well. We lost a few hives and the remaining hives numbers were low but the great news is they are recovering beautifully.  We have been trying to update our website, but with spring cleanup and trying to get the girls and some boys on their way again to building their family and producing Honey bee products. It’s hard to find the time. Our Spring weather  right now is a bit on the wet and cool side. The Spring flowering trees and plants are beginning to bloom, but when it gets cold and rainy the girls are not real crazy about going out into it. Who would be. But when the sun comes out and it reaches about 45 degrees, wow are the girls busy. Well that’s about it for now, keep checking our web site for updates.

Happenings in the Bee Yard

5/17/2012

1 Comment

 
Welcome to Earthway Primitives Apiary (EPA)
After a very unusual winter here in WV our Girls & Boys are building up very nicely. We have made three splits and purchased two packages which brings our total hive count to ten. This weekend we are setting up at our local Master Gardeners Spring Clinic here in North Central WV. We will have our observation hive set up and sell our wildflower honey and Cindy's locally famous soaps & lip balm. Stay tuned for pictures.
